MULLIN v. BD. OF EDUC. OF THE EAST RAMAPO CENT. SCH. DIST.


78 A.D.2d 899 (1980)

Richard Mullin, Individually and as President of The East Ramapo Teachers Association, et al., Appellants, v. Board of Education of the East Ramapo Central School District et al., Respondents

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

November 24, 1980


Order modified by adding thereto, after the words "dismissed in all respects", the following: "except that it is declared that the curriculum is the province of the school board and there was no violation of plaintiffs First Amendment rights." As so modified, order affirmed, with $50 costs and disbursements payable to defendants.
